Michael Carberry of Hampshire has been selected to represent England in the T20Is to be played against Australia on 29th and 31st August.

Carberry scored 502 runs at an average of 55.77, helping the club reach the semi-finals of the Friends Life T-20 tournament. He previously represented his country in a solitary Test at Chittagong in Bangladesh, almost three years ago.

England announced a 13-man team for the two games, which has seen the inclusion of Steve Finn and Stuart Broad, both of whom had missed the series against New Zealand in June earlier this year.

Broad will lead the side and hope to gain some momentum ahead of the T20I World Cup scheduled in Bangladesh, six months from now.

“With only eight international T20 matches until the World T20 next April this series is an important chance for players to show they are capable of performing well at this level,” national selector Geoff Miller said.

“The two matches will also allow Ashley Giles and Stuart Broad an opportunity to look at a number of different options,” Miller added.

England squad:

Stuart Broad (C), Ravi Bopara, Danny Briggs, Jos Buttler (WK), Michael Carberry, Jade Dernbach, Steven Finn, Alex Hales, Michael Lumb, Eoin Morgan, Boyd Rankin, Joe Root, James Tredwell, Luke Wright.
